タグ

検索に関するinc-2734のブックマーク (6)

  • [WordPress]pre_get_postsを使ったカスタムタクソノミーの複雑な条件検索 | Wood-Roots:blog

    この記事のコードはちゃんと動いてませんでした。近日中に修正いたします。 2014.04.03追記: 修正版書きました 以前カスタムタクソノミーを好みの条件で検索する方法として、カスタムタクソノミーを使った複雑な条件検索というエントリーを書きました。 当時は$_GETで得た値をtax_queryに突っ込むという方法を取っていましたが、$_GETを直接取得するというのは明らかにダサいですしWordPressらしくもありません。 そこで検索に用いるタクソノミー名をクエリオブジェクトより取得する方法を改めて考えてみました。ついでに通常のループ+pre_get_postsで取得できるようにしてみました。 DEMO(実際に検索できます) カスタムタクソノミー定義時の注意 カスタムタクソノミーはregister_taxonomy関数で定義しますが、その際「query_var」というオプションをtrueに

  • Googleのヒット件数は当てにならない - アスペ日記

    (2013/11/08: 補足を書きました。Googleのヒット件数について(続き)) 「Googleの検索件数は当てにならない」と言うと、多くの人は「何をいまさら」という反応かもしれません。 当てにならないことぐらいわかってるよ、と。 でも、「当てにならない」でイメージするものがどの程度かは人によって違うと思います。 結果が2倍ぐらい違ったりする、程度に思っている人もいるかもしれません。 しかし、実際はそんなレベルでの話ではありません。 「当は50件なのに500,000件と返ってくる」ようなことも珍しくありません。 たとえば、ツイッターで見たネタなのですが、"無い内定式" というキーワードで検索してみます。 267,000件。 多いですね。 ここで、10ページ目をクリックすると、次のようになります。 「59 件中 6 ページ目」*1 一気に4桁も減ってしまいました。 どちらが当の数字

    Googleのヒット件数は当てにならない - アスペ日記
  • 不動産サイトの絞り込み検索 | Taiyo Blog / WordPress

    情報を追記している場合はありますが、古い情報を訂正はしていませんので、公開年月日を参照してください。プラグイン・タグ、いずれもワードプレス・PHPのバージョン等によって動作しない場合もあります。 2012年に書いた絞り込み検索の記事にちょくちょくアクセスがあるのだけど、記事が古いので、昨年作成した不動産サイトの例を覚え書きとして。 カスタム投稿タイプ売買と賃貸、それぞれタクソノミーが種別(一戸建て、マンションなど)と地域と沿線、カスタムフィールドで価格や特記事項。 フォームは種別のアーカイブに表示。種別によって内容が違うので、それぞれで分岐。以下は売買・一戸建ての地域と沿線(子タームが駅)、それぞれタームと投稿数をチェックボックスで。 結果側は売買と賃貸でページが違うので、投稿タイプの値は入れていない。 <form method="get" id="searchform" action="

    不動産サイトの絞り込み検索 | Taiyo Blog / WordPress
  • http://wordpress.rauru-block.org/index.php/1566

  • WordPressのサイト内検索の検索条件をカスタマイズする

    WordPress3.3.2を使用しています。 2012.06.01 「投稿記事だけ検索したい」に抜けている部分があったので修正しました。 検索フォームの設置 一つのテキストフォームだけで検索する場合は以下のコードを表示させたい位置に配置するだけですね。 wp template <div id="search-box"> <form method="get" action="<?php bloginfo( 'url' ); ?>"> <input name="s" id="s" type="text" /> <input id="submit" type="submit" value="検索" /> </form> </div> あとは「search.php」を作成して適当にループさせれば検索結果が表示されます。 投稿記事だけ検索したい 標準のサイト内検索は固定ページも検索範囲に含まれて

    WordPressのサイト内検索の検索条件をカスタマイズする
  • WordPress 特定のカテゴリーから絞込み検索するカスタマイズ | mono-lab

    WordPressのテンプレート、プラグイン、 カスタマイズ情報を紹介しています。 WPを利用したホームページの制作も承っております。 以前、特定のカテゴリーを検索対象から除外するカスタマイズ方法を紹介しましたが、 今回は特定のカテゴリーから絞込み検索する方法を説明します。 はじめに、絞込みをするカテゴリーのIDを管理画面から調べ、 <form> タグの下に2行目のコードを記述してください。 <form method="get" id="searchform" action="<?php bloginfo('url'); ?>/"> <input type="hidden" value="5" name="cat" /> この場合、カテゴリーIDが5のカテゴリーのみ検索の対象になります。 次に紹介する方法は、絞込みするカテゴリーのドロップダウンメニューを表示する方法です。 2行目のコードを

  • 1